When it comes to the most beautiful languages of the world in my opinion, French and Portuguese are tied for first place. I found a wonderful new ad for the Yazigi school made by ad agency ESPM from São Paulo, Brasil. The artwork is wonderful, groovy fun e beleza!
We teach you all English levels: Beginner, intermediate, advanced and Arnold Schwarzenegger.
Of course speaking another language helps your career. Who else kisses up to the boss in two different languages?
Art Director: Rodrigo Daud
Copywriter: Otávio Mastrogiuseppe
Illustrator: Rodrigo Daud
